Slack Welcome Automation
The Zapier Integration Method:
Since Slack doesn't have built-in DM automation, use Zapier to create welcome workflows.
Step-by-Step: Slack Welcome Bot Setup
Step 1: Create Zapier Account
Go to https://zapier.com
Sign up for free account
Connect your Slack workspace
Step 2: Create New Zap
Click "Create Zap"
Search for "Slack" as trigger app
Select trigger: "New Member Joined Channel"
Connect your Slack account
Select your welcome channel
Step 3: Configure Action
Add action: Slack > "Send Direct Message"
Connect your Slack account (if not already)
Design your welcome message
Test the integration
Turn on the Zap

Telegram Welcome Automation
Built-in Telegram Features:
1. Welcome Message in Groups
Telegram groups support automatic welcome messages natively.
Setup:
Open your Telegram group as admin
Go to Group Settings
Navigate to "Group Type" settings
Enable "Send welcome message"
Compose your welcome text

3. Telegram Bots for Advanced Automation
Rose Bot:
Advanced welcome messages
Rules enforcement
Custom buttons
Media support (images, GIFs)
Setup:
Add @MissRose_bot to your group
Make it an admin
Use /setwelcome command
Customize with formatting and buttons
Combot:
Welcome messages with buttons
Analytics
Engagement tracking
Free and premium tiers

Measuring Welcome Automation Success
Key Metrics to Track
1. Mobile App Adoption Rate
Formula: (Members who downloaded app ÷ Total new members) × 100
Benchmarks:
Poor: <40%
Average: 40-60%
Good: 60-80%
Excellent: 80%+
How to Track:
Survey members at onboarding
Monitor platform-specific analytics
Check active device types
Ask directly in welcome flow
2. First-Week Engagement Rate
What to Measure:
Percentage who post in first 7 days
Number of messages sent
Channels visited
Resources accessed
Events attended
Benchmark:
Aim for 70%+ to engage within first week
3. Churn Rate Comparison
Compare:
Members who got welcome message vs. those who didn't
Members who downloaded app vs. those who didn't
Members who took onboarding actions vs. passive members
Expected Impact:
20-40% lower churn with proper welcome automation
4. Time to First Action
Track:
How long until first post/message
Speed of introduction
App download timing
Resource access timing
Goal:
First action within 24 hours
App download within 48 hours
Introduction within 3 days
5. Welcome Message Open/Read Rate
Platform-Specific:
Discord: Track DM delivery success
Slack: Monitor message read receipts
Telegram: Check message view counts
Benchmark:
Aim for 85%+ open rate

Common Welcome Automation Mistakes
Mistake 1: No Welcome Message at All
The Problem: Members join and hear crickets. They feel ignored, don't know where to start, and quickly lose interest.
The Fix: Implement basic welcome automation immediately. Even a simple automated message is infinitely better than silence.
Mistake 2: Overwhelming Information Dump
The Problem: 3,000-word welcome message with 47 links and 15 action items. Members feel overwhelmed and do nothing.
The Fix: Keep welcome messages concise. Focus on 3-5 key actions. Provide a "getting started" resource for deep dives.
Mistake 3: Generic, Impersonal Messages
The Problem: "Welcome to the community. Please read the rules." Cold, corporate, uninviting.
The Fix: Use their name, show enthusiasm, be human, demonstrate you care about their success.
Mistake 4: Burying Mobile App Download
The Problem: Mobile app mentioned as an afterthought at the end, or not at all.
The Fix: Make mobile app download the #1 priority action. Lead with it, emphasize the 34% retention stat, provide direct links.
Mistake 5: No Clear Next Steps
The Problem: Welcome message ends with "Enjoy the community!" but no guidance on what to actually do.
The Fix: Always end with clear, specific next steps. Tell them exactly what to do first, second, third.
Mistake 6: Forgetting to Highlight Value
The Problem: Welcome message is all logistics and setup, no reminder of why they joined and what they'll gain.
The Fix: Reinforce their decision. Remind them of key benefits. Show excitement about what they'll achieve.
Mistake 7: One-and-Done Welcome
The Problem: Send welcome message, then ignore the new member for weeks unless they reach out first.
The Fix: Follow up within 3-7 days. Check in, ask how it's going, offer help, encourage engagement.
Mistake 8: Broken or Missing Links
The Problem: "Download the app here: [broken link]" or vague "visit our website" without actual link.
The Fix: Always use direct, working links. Test every link. Make clicking easy (especially on mobile).
Mistake 9: Platform-Inappropriate Automation
The Problem: Copying Discord welcome strategy exactly to Slack without adjusting for platform differences.
The Fix: Tailor welcome messages to each platform's culture, features, and user expectations.
Mistake 10: Not Measuring or Optimizing
The Problem: Set up welcome message once three years ago, never looked at it again, no idea if it's working.
The Fix: Track metrics, test variations, gather feedback, continuously improve based on data.
